Web27 Aug 2024 · 2. Install a bird bath (essential for birds) Install a bird bath, an essential element to attract any bird, to entice crows to your area. Water is extremely important for all birds, and crows are no different. Crows need water for bathing, drinking, eating, and feather maintenance, not to mention cooling off in the summer heat. Web31 Mar 2024 · Appearance. Also known as the the 4-spot ladybird for its four red spots. The two nearest the head are comma shaped. The rest of the body and head is entirely black and the edges of the wing cases have a pronounced lip. WebChough. Scientific name: Pyrrhocorax pyrrhocorax. As the only crow with a red bill and red legs, the all-black chough is easy to identify. But it's harder to spot: there are only small, coastal populations in Scotland, Ireland, Wales and the Isle of Man.

Experts believe that these large gatherings of crows may provide warmth, protection, social opportunities, and a chance to share knowledge about food sources. Web15 Apr 2024 · Buzzard ( Buteo buteo) Appearance: a buzzard ’s primary feathers are a distinct shape: thinner on one side than the other, with a slight notch missing from the top half. One side of the feather is dark brown while the other has a brown upper part with dark bars. The base of the feather is cream. Secondary feathers are shorter and rounder. WebSome crow nestlings are almost naked and have large, pinkish bills. Another remarkable characteristic of baby crows is their blue eyes which make crow chicks and juveniles reasonably easy to spot amongst adults. Newly hatched Crow chicks in the nest, being fed by one of their parents.

Web20 Jan 2024 · The marsh harrier flies with its wings lifted up in an obvious ‘V’ shape, though this can be hard to see from below. Patrolling low over reedbeds, it keeps its head down to scan for prey. Eats small mammals and birds. They also have two black eyes, a black beak, and dark legs. Its 36-inch wingspan means this bird prefers to fly in open areas. They measure from 16 to 20 inches from the tip of the beak to their tail feathers. Found in northwest Scotland, the Scottish Islands, Isle of Man and Ireland, it was recently recognised as a separate species.
